Datta Repeats as CACC Men's Cross Country Champion

Blitzes Field at 26:43, nearly 30 seconds ahead of next runner; Cougars Men Take Seventh Overall

PHILADELPHIA -- Junior Joey Datta (Edison, N.J.) ran away from the field, securing his second consecutive CACC Men's Cross Country individual championship to highlight the day at Belmont Plateau. Datta ran the 8K course in 26:43.00, outdistancing the nearest competitor by nearly 30 seconds in the dominant win.

Datta's performance was supported by teammates freshman Alex Jamieson (Portree, Scotland), who placed 35th at 31:38.21, senior Alexander Geddes (Randolph, N.J.; ; 31:58.08, 43rd); freshman Logan Kudla (Bloomfield, N.J., 34:35.99, 49th) and soph Pharrell Mensah (Metuchen, N.J.; 37:06.72, 55th) as the Cougars took seventh place among the 11 teams.

Datta once again qualified for the NCAA Division II East Region Championship in two weeks in Rindge, N.H.
